Show H HOMESTEADING IN THE WEST. H The Borah homestead bill is still held in- conference, the point H of difference between the,senate and house being over the question H as to whether the law should be made retroactive and apply to H pending entries as well -as future homesteads. H The measure as framed by the Idaho senator would allow final j .- proof to be made within three years and cause a rush to be made H b' prospective homesteaders for land open to entry. H Ihc time Ives arrived when the old restrictions calling for five j years can be reduced to three years with the requirement of a H greatly reduced period of actual residence, without danger of the H public lands so located falling into the hands of monopolists or H speculators. The best western lands long since have been taken up H and the areas now open to entry should be made more inviting to j homesteaders by reducing the onerous demands of the present H homestead laws, y |
